TGV 001. The TGV 001 was an experimental gas turbine-electric locomotive -powered trainset built by Alstom to break speed records between 250–300 kilometres per hour. It was the first TGV prototype and was commissioned in 1969, to begin testing in 1972. It achieved a top speed of 318 kilometres per hour (198 mph) on 8 December 1972.

The fastest magnetically levitated (maglev) train runs at the speed of 603 km/h (374.68 mph), achieved by the Series L0 (A07) which was operated by the Central Japan Railway Company on the Yamanashi Maglev Line, in Yamanashi, Japan, on 21 April 2015. The Yamanashi Maglev Line is currently a test line.

In ... The following is a list of high-speed trains that have been, are, or will be in commercial service. A high-speed train is generally defined as one which operates at or over 125 mph (200 km/h) in regular passenger service, with a high level of service, and often comprising multi-powered elements. Shanghai Maglev trains are currently the fastest trains commercially operated in the world, with a top commercial speed of 431 kph (268 mph) and a top non-commercial speed of 501 kph (311 mph).. China's Beijing–Shanghai HSR holds the record for the fastest unmodified electric wheeled train, at a highest speed of 487 kph (303 mph), set in 2010 …Sep 26, 2023 · Shanghai Maglev Train (Shanghai Maglev Demonstration Line) is the first commercial maglev line in the world. The line runs between Longyang Road Station on the Shanghai Subway Line 2, to Pudong International Airport, and the journey takes no more than 8 minutes to complete the distance of 30 km (19 miles).
